We built the company around one observation. Roofs in Deep East Texas fail at the edge, and almost nobody prices that honestly. So we probe the eave before we quote, we separate the carpentry from the covering on paper, and we photograph what we find. It has cost us jobs against companies that quoted a shingle number and discovered the rot later. We would rather lose those.

Here is when not to hire us. If the roof needs one pipe boot or a few tabs and you have a handyman you trust, use him, because our minimum will not make sense for that work. If you want the cheapest possible number and you do not want the eave opened, we are the wrong company. And if the plan is to get a worn-out roof paid for as storm damage, we will decline.

Why Nacogdoches Chooses Nacogdoches Roof Pros

  • We open the eave before we quote. Every proposal carries a per-foot rate for fascia and rafter-tail repair with a written cap, so the wood is never a surprise.
  • We will not wrap aluminum coil over a fascia board we have not probed, which happens to be the most profitable single thing a roofer can sell in this county.
  • Moisture scan and a core cut before any coating or recover. If the deck reads wet we tear off, explain why, and give you the sample to look at.
  • Maintenance and storm damage go onto separate documents, so a claim file never mixes five years of decay with fifteen minutes of wind and loses both.
  • Powered attic fans come out rather than go in. Baffled static ventilation sized to the attic square footage, with the soffit intake actually opened back up.
